Doctors must complete a four-year undergraduate program, along with four years in medical school and three to seven years in a residency program to learn the specialty they chose to pursue. In other words, it takes between 10 to 14 years to become a fully licensed doctor.

Web23 jan. 2024 · In Australia, an MBBS can take between 4-6 years depending on where you study. Following this is a period of postgraduate study to focus on a specialism, such as training to be a General Practitioner (GP), which usually takes between 3-5 years to complete. Web20 nov. 2024 · Becoming a licensed doctor takes at least 10 to 14 years. The journey of becoming a doctor begins with completing a four-year undergraduate degree from an accredited university. As getting into a medical school is very competitive, it's advisable to get your undergraduate degree in a scientific field and achieve a high grade.
